Abstract
The invention discloses a novel anti-corrosion rubber sealing gasket. The novel anti-corrosion rubber sealing gasket comprises an inner layer, a middle layer and an outer layer. The inner layer, the middle layer and the outer layer are sequentially bonded from inside to outside. The outer layer is provided with a long groove. The inner layer is composed of, by weight, 40-55 parts of natural compounded rubber, 15-20 parts of polyvinyl chloride resin, 5-8 parts of nano barium sulfate, 3-6 parts of mineral oil, 1.5-4.5 parts of neoprene factice, 4-8 parts of carbon black, 2.5-4.5 parts of plasticizer, 0.5-2.5 parts of heat stabilizer, 1.5-3.5 parts of antioxidant and 1.2-3.5 parts of accelerant. In this way, the novel anti-corrosion rubber sealing gasket has good in chemical acid and alkali resistance, is particularly suitable for chemical liquid drainage, and meanwhile has good sealing performance.

Embodiment
Be clearly and completely described to the technological scheme in the embodiment of the present invention below, obviously, described embodiment is only a part of embodiment of the present invention, instead of whole embodiments.Based on the embodiment in the present invention, those of ordinary skill in the art, not making other embodiments all obtained under creative work prerequisite, belong to the scope of protection of the invention.
Refer to Fig. 1, in one embodiment.
A kind of novel corrosion resistant rubber gasket, comprises internal layer 1, mesosphere 2 and outer 3, and described internal layer 1, mesosphere 2 and outer 3 bondingly successively from the inside to surface form, and described outer 3 are provided with elongate recesses 3-1.
Further, the thickness of described internal layer is 5mm ~ 8mm, and internal layer 1 is made up of the raw material of following weight portion: natural mixed rubber 48, PVC=polyvinyl chloride tree 18.50, nano barium sulfate 7.5, mineral oil 5, neoprene ointment 3, carbon black 7, plasticizing agent 3.8, heat stabilizer 2.2, antioxidant 3.2, promoter 3.1.
Further, described neoprene ointment is made up of following raw material: neoprene, polypropylene plastics, plasticizing agent, vulcanzing agent, plasticizer, age resister and solvent.
Further, the degree of depth of described outer 3 elongate recesses 3-1 is that 10mm, elongate recesses 3-1 can carry out bar-shaped trough sealing with equipment, has good sealing effect.
Further, described mesosphere 2 is provided with ventilative 2-1.
